In this classic point-and-click adventure anthology you follow the path of Dale Vandermeer, a homicide detective, as he investigates the death of a woman and finds himself drawn into the mysterious world of Rusty Lake. Cube Escape was Rusty Lake's first series of games, introducing the Rusty Lake universe. Heavily inspired by TV series Twin Peaks. All games will be updated, preserved and bundled on Steam for a small price, to survive the end of the Flash Games era. The Cube Escape Collection will contain 9 chapters: Seasons, The Lake, Arles, Harvey's Box, Case 23, The Mill, Birthday, Theatre and The Cave. Thanks for your support! PLEASE NOTE: These games do not contain any new content from their original versions (besides achievements, a new hint system and translations)!

Cube Escape Collection is a collection (duh) of the first 9 Cube Escape games made by Rusty Lake, gameplay order is listen in the menu, but you should also play Rusty Lake Hotel after The Mill and Rusty Lake Roots after Theatre, as advised by the developers I think Cube Escape (And the Rusty Lake series) in general is the best point and click puzzle game series out there, it even has a intriguing story with some occasional horror so I am glad they survived the great flash game destruction in the form of this collection
